Facebook: For the best click-through rate, bitly suggestsposting to Facebook between 1 p.m. and 4 p.m. EST. Wednesday at 3 p.m. EST isthe peak time of the week to post. Traffic from Facebook fades after 4 p.m.Weekend posts often get less attention than weekdays.
Twitter: Your best chance of getting high click counts onTwitter is with tweets sent in the afternoon earlier in the week -- namely 1p.m. to 3 p.m. EST, Monday through Thursday. Bitly suggests users avoid postingafter 8 p.m. or after 3 p.m. on Fridays. As with Facebook, weekend tweets areless effective than those sent during the week.

Tumblr: This social network has a "drasticallydifferent pattern of usage" than Facebook or Twitter, bitly says. Tumblrtraffic from bitly links peaks between 7 p.m. and 10 p.m. EST on Monday andTuesday, with similar traffic on Sunday. Friday evening -- a time that'sgenerally ineffective for other networks -- can be an optimal time to post onTumblr. On average, content posted after 7 p.m. receives more clicks over 24hours than mid-day posts during the week.
